CC Work Session 2. 3. <br /> Meeting Date: 03/28/2017 <br /> Submitted For: Patrick Brama,Administrative Services <br /> By: Patrick Brama,Administrative Services <br /> Information <br /> Title: <br /> Arterial Infrastructure to Serve Ramsey's Future Business Park&Capstone Homes Development <br /> Purpose/Background: <br /> PURPOSE <br /> Introduce the attached Capstone Homes proposal for funding and constructing arterial infrastructure improvements <br /> located on Bunker Lake Boulevard and Puma Street adjacent to the City's new business park. The purpose of this <br /> case is to allow the Council to identify any information missing from this case needed to formally process/respond <br /> to the request from Capstone Homes in April, and this is not a request to make a final/formal decision RE the <br /> Capstone Proposal. This case will come back to the Council in April for formal direction. <br /> Staff welcomes questions, suggestions, and preliminary feedback. <br /> BACKGROUND &ALTERNATIVES <br /> Please see attached documents. <br /> GUESTS <br /> Staff anticipates the following guests to be in attendance of this meeting/case: Steve Bona of Capstone Homes,Al <br /> Pearson of Pearson Farms,John Dobbs the Pearson Farms Broker, Jason Aarsvold of Ehlers, Michael Altimari of <br /> Hageman Holdings, and Matt Kuker of PSD. These guests will be available to answer questions and provide <br /> additional background information if needed. <br /> Notification: <br /> NA <br /> Observations/Alternatives: <br /> Please see attached "alternatives" document. <br /> Funding Source: <br /> TBD <br /> Recommendation: <br /> The EDA reviewed this case on 03/09. Attached are draft EDA minutes. Below is a summary of preliminary EDA <br /> feedback: <br /> .The EDA is generally open to considering the option of using EDA dollars for funding this project, if the <br /> Council so desires. <br /> .The EDA is generally interested in this project, and is generally interested in finding a solution that all <br /> parties can accept. <br /> .The EDA wanted information to be provided RE the bonding option.
